1.Relationship between Apoptosis of Bone Marrow Cells and Tumor Necrosis Factor-?,Fas/FasL Expression in Children with Aplastic Anemia
xiao-qing, ZHAO ; fu-tian, MA ; bao-xi, ZHANG ; xiao-li, WU
Journal of Applied Clinical Pediatrics 2006;0(15):-
Objective To investigate the relationship between apoptosis of bone marrow cells and tumor necrosis factor-?(TNF-?),Fas/FasL expression in children with aplastic anemia.Methods The concentration of TNF-? in supernatant of cultured bone marrow mononuclear cell(BMMC) was measured by enzyme linked immunosorbent assay.The expression of Fas/FasL,apoptosis ratio of bone marrow CD34+ cell were evaluated by flow cytometry.Results The concentration of TNF-? in supernatant of cultured BMMC in AA group[SAA (27.9?8.20) ng/L;CAA (23.6?6.78) ng/L] increased significantly compared with control group(t=3.432 P0.05).Apoptosis ratio of CD34+ cell in SAA group[(24.6?9.56)%] and CAA group[(20.9?7.32)%] significantly increased compared with control group(t=3.492,3.458 Pa0.05).The concentration of TNF-? was positively correlated with the expression of CD34+ Fas+ in all types AA children(r=0.542 P0.05).Conclusions TNF-? and Fas/FasL system can be involved in inducing CD34+ cell apoptosis.This may contribute to understanding the decreased number of stem cells and bone marrow failure.

3.Serum uric acid as an index of impaired renal function in congestive heart failure
Yu TIAN ; Ying CHEN ; Bao DENG ; Gang LIU ; Zhenguo JI ; Qingzhen ZHAO ; Yuzhi ZHEN ; Yanqiu GAO ; Li TIAN ; Le WANG ; Lishuang JI ; Guoping MA ; Kunshen LIU ; Chao LIU
Journal of Geriatric Cardiology 2012;09(2):137-142
Background Hyperuricemia is frequently present in patients with heart failure. Many pathological conditions, such as tissue ischemia, renal function impairment, cardiac function impairment, metabolic syndrome, and inflammatory status, may impact uric acid (UA) metabolism. This study was to assess their potential relations to UA metabolism in heart failure. Methods We retrospectively assessed clinical characteristics, echocardiological, renal, metabolic and inflammatory variables selected on the basis of previous evidence of their involvement in cardiovascular diseases and UA metabolism in a large cohort of randomly selected adults with congestive heart failure (n = 553). By clustering of indices, those variables were explored using factor analysis. Results In factor analysis, serum uric acid (SUA) formed part of a principal cluster of renal functional variables which included serum creatinine (SCr) and blood urea nitrogen (BUN). Univariate correlation coefficients between variables of patients with congestive heart failure showed that the strongest correlations for SUA were with BUN (r = 0.48, P < 0.001) and SCr (r = 0.47, P < 0.001). Conclusions There was an inverse relationship between SUA levels and measures of renal function in patients with congestive heart failure. The strong correlation between SUA and SCr and BUN levels suggests that elevated SUA concentrations reflect an impairment of renal function in heart failure.
4.Association of the PADI4 gene polymorphism and HLA-DRB1 shared epitope alleles with rheumatoid arthritis.
Lie-ying FAN ; Ming ZONG ; Tian-bao LU ; Lin YANG ; Yuan-yuan DING ; Jian-wei MA
Chinese Journal of Medical Genetics 2009;26(1):57-61
OBJECTIVETo investigate the association of single nucleotide polymorphisms (SNPs) of the peptidylarginine deiminase IV (PADI4) and HLA-DRB1 shared epitope (SE) alleles with rheumatoid arthritis(RA) in a Chinese population.
METHODSFour exonic SNPs of the PADI4 gene (PADI 4_89*A/G, PADI 4_90*C/T, PADI 4_92*C/G and PADI 4_104*C/T) were genotyped in 67 unrelated patients with RA and 81 healthy controls, using cDNA sequencing and T vector cloning. HLA-DRB 1*01, *04 and *10 subtypes were determined by polymerase chain reaction with sequence specific primers (PCR-SSP).
RESULTSThe distributions of the 4 SNPs were different in the two groups, and increased RA susceptibility was significantly associated with the minor alleles of PADI 4_89*G (P was 0.023), PADI 4_90*T (P was 0.004), PADI 4_104*T (P was 0.003), and the haplotypes carrying the 4 minor alleles (P was 0.008). HLA-DRB1 SE alleles are composed of HLA-DRB 1*0101, *0102, *0401, *0404, *0405, *0408, *0409, *0410 and *1001. Individuals carrying the SE alleles were associated with increased RA susceptibility (P was 0.002). Individuals carrying both the SE alleles and minor alleles of the 4 SNPs were more susceptible to RA than individuals carrying neither the minor SNP alleles nor the SE alleles.
CONCLUSIONThe PADI4 SNPs and haplotypes are associated with RA susceptibility in Chinese. HLA-DRB1 shared epitope is also an important risky factor for RA. There may exist certain synergistic effect between the PADI4 minor alleles and the HLA-DRB1 shared epitope.

5.Impact of different mediastinal lymphadenectomy on clinical-stage IA non-small cell lung cancer.
Kai MA ; Tian-You WANG ; Bao-Liang HE ; Dong CHANG ; Min GONG
Chinese Journal of Surgery 2008;46(9):670-673
OBJECTIVETo study the role of different lymphadenectomy in the treatment of selected clinical-stage IA non-small cell lung cancer.
METHODSAll 115 postoperative patients admitted from January 1997 to May 2002 with pathologic-stage T1 who had been preoperatively diagnosed as clinical-stage I A non-small cell lung cancer were divided into a radical systematic mediastinal lymphadenectomy (LA) group and a mediastinal lymph node sampling (LS) group. Impacts on morbidity, N staging, overall survival (OS) and disease-free survival (DFS) were evaluated in each group respectively. Associations between clinical-pathological parameters (age, sex, tumor location, tumor size, pathological type and lymph node metastases) and OS, DFS were analyzed. The cumulative OS and DFS was calculated by the Kaplan-Meier method and compared by the Log-rank test.
RESULTSThe mean number of dissected lymph nodes was (15.98 +/- 3.05) in LA group and (6.48 +/- 2.16) in LS group with a significant difference (P < 0.01). No statistically significant difference existed in modification of N staging, OS and DFS between LA group and LS group. However, for patients with lesions of a diameter more than 2 cm, 5-year OS in LA group was significantly higher than that in LS groups (LA vs. LS = 78.2% vs. 54.5% ,P < 0.05), also 5-year DFS was significantly higher (LA vs. LS = 75.1% vs. 51.3%, P < 0.05). For patients with lesions of 2 cm or less, 5-year OS and 5-year DFS were similar in both groups. The early surgery-related parameters (duration of surgery, drain secretion and morbidity) indicated a slighter invasion in LS group. In addition, patients with large cell carcinoma and adenosquamous carcinoma were associated with significantly poor 5-year OS (P < 0.05) , and patients with lymph node metastases were associated with poor 5-year OS as well as 5-year DFS (P < 0.01).
CONCLUSIONSAfter being intraoperatively identified as T1 stage, patients with lesions of more than 2 cm in clinical-stage IA non-small cell lung cancer should be performed with LA to get a better survival, and patients with lesions of 2 cm or less should be performed with LS to decrease invasion.

7.Effect of interleukin 21 and/or interleukin 12 on the antitumor activity of peripheral blood mononuclear cells in patients with endometrial cancer.
Yong-ju TIAN ; Bao-xia CUI ; Dao-xin MA ; Yan ZHANG ; Fei HOU ; Wen-jing ZHANG
Acta Academiae Medicinae Sinicae 2011;33(3):292-298
OBJECTIVETo observe the role of interleukin (IL) 21 alone, IL12 alone, and IL21 plus IL12 for inducing the antitumor activity of peripheral blood mononuclear cells (PBMCs) in patients with endometrial cancer.
METHODSPBMCs were isolated from peripheral blood in patients with endometrial cancer in vitro, and kept the culture with low-level IL2. IL2-stimulated PBMCs were cocultured under different conditions (with anti-IL21 antibody, IL21 alone, IL12 alone, or IL21 plus IL12) for 72 h. The cytotoxicity of PBMCs was then examined by lactate dehydrogenase(LDH) released assay. CD4(+) CD25(+) FOXP3(+) regulatory (Treg) cell and CD4(+) IL17A(+) T-helper (Th17) cell proportion were determined with flow cytometry. Cell proliferation and apoptosis were measured by cell counting kit-8(CCK-8)assay and flow cytometry, respectively.
RESULTSIn comparison to control group, both IL21 and IL12 significantly enhanced the cytotoxicity of PBMCs. The IL21 plus IL12 group had superior effect to IL21 alone and IL12 alone. IL21 and IL12 significantly decreased the percentages of Treg cells and the rate of PBMCs apoptosis. IL21 or IL12 had no significant effect on the differentiation of Th17 cells and the proliferation of PBMCs.
CONCLUSIONSIL21 and IL12 can enhance the cytotoxicity of PBMCs in patients with endometrial cancer, which can be further strengthened with treatment of IL21 plus IL12. Such effects may be achieved by inhibiting the differentiation of Treg cells and the apoptosis of PBMCs, but not by the differentiation of Th17 cell.

9.Endoscopic repair of nasal septal perforation with acellular dermal matrix and pedicled mucoperichondrial flap
You-Xiang MA ; An-Zhou TAO ; Cheng LU ; Hao TIAN ; Bao-Cheng DONG
Chinese Journal of Otorhinolaryngology Head and Neck Surgery 2011;46(6):455-458
Objective To introduce the method and evaluate the efficacy of endoscopic repair of nasal septal perforation with acellular dermal matrix and pedicled mucoperichondrial flap. Methods Twelve patients with perforation of nasal septum were encountered since February 2006 to October 2010. The most common symptoms and sings were nasal obstruction and crusting at the margin of the perforation. Eight of 12 patients were iatrogenic following surgery. The perforation typically located at anterior medial part of the nasal septum, with their sizes ranged approximately 1. 0 -2. 3 cm in diameter. The incision was made at the anterior edge of the perforation from the left nasal cavity and continued to the nasal floor horizontally. It ended at the lateral nasal cavity. Then, another incision was made parallel to the first one, which was 1.5 cm from the posterior of the perforation. The two incisions was connected. The mucoperichondrium was stripped along with the incisions and the pedicle of mucoperichondrial flap kept on the nasal septum. Then,the flap was turned up to cover the perforation and fixed with apposition suture. Put the acellular dermal matrix graft on the perforation from the right nasal cavity and fixed it with apposition suture. Results The healing of the acellular dermal matrix and mucoperichondrium was good in the first week postoperatively and there was no rejective reaction and contracture. The epithelization of the nasal septal perforation finished 4 weeks after surgery. Follow-up ranged from 3 months to 4 years. Eleven patients had successful outcomes with complete closure of their perforations. One patient failed the operation. All of them had no complications. Conclusions Using acellular dermal matrix graft and mucoperichondrial flap to repair the septal perforation is a simple method and the success rate is high. Therefore, it is an effective way to repair the perforation of nasal septum.
10.Study on active ingredient and mechanism in preventing vascular dementia of Tianzhusan coming from Tujia medicine.
Wen-bin ZHOU ; Li LIN ; Zhi-yong LI ; Tian BI ; Tian-yuan YE ; Cui-qiang MA ; Bao HONG-JUAN ; Hong-ping WANG ; Bai-xia ZHANG ; Kuo-kui SONG ; Yan-wen LI ; Yun WANG
China Journal of Chinese Materia Medica 2015;40(13):2668-2673
To make clear of the absorbed components of Tianzhusan (TZS) and its possible mechanism in preventing vascular dementia (VD), the rats' models of VD were prepared by a permanent ligation of the bilateral common carotid arteries. After 60 days, rats were administrated with TZS for 0.1 g x kg(-1), and the volume is 0.02 mL x g(-1). After 3 days, the medicated serum was prepared and detected by UPLC, and then we predicted the possible chemical structure of the absorbed components of TZS. According to the absorbed components, the potential targets of TZS were found by ligand profiling of Discovery Studio 3.5. All of these target genes were submitted to DAVID onine for gene set enrichment analysis (GSEA). The 5 absorbed components of TZS have been predicted, and four of them have been identified as parishin B, parishin C, parishin, pennogenin-3-O-alpha-L-rhamnopyranosy-(1-->2)-beta-D-glucoside. Through reverse finding targets, we got 861 pharmacophore models and 9 pathways from KEGG, BIOCARTA after document verification. These results showed that the efficacy mechanism of TZS on VD perhaps were be related with these absorbed components and pathways. If the traditional herbs could be proved effective by efficacy tests, the serum pharmacochemistry, computer-aided drug design, system biology and other technologies can be used in the next experiments, which will be beneficial to fast discovery of material basis and mechanisms of traditional medicine coming form ethnic minorities.
